Pest control companies help people keep their homes insect-free, but they can’t do it alone. Here are some things every exterminator in Rockford wishes people would do before their appointments.

Note the Pests’ Location

Exterminators can’t always spot every pest. That’s because some pests, like cockroaches, spend much of their time hiding. So, it’s helpful if people can write down where they’ve spotted the pests and relay this information to the exterminator. It saves a lot of guesswork and time.

Move Furniture Away from the Walls

Exterminators don’t have time to move furniture and other household items away from the walls. They’ll expect their customers to do this before they arrive. If the furniture isn’t moved, the exterminator won’t be able to apply the treatments correctly.

Remove Items from Cabinets

If the exterminator is spraying inside kitchen or bathroom cabinets, remove all items from these areas. Exterminators’ chemicals are safe for interior treatment, but one still doesn’t want the chemicals coating their dishes and other items.

Relocate Pets Before Treatment

Exterminators don’t want to work around pets. Cats, dogs, rabbits, gerbils, and other furry friends should be relocated to parts of the house that aren’t being treated. Caged pets, such as amphibians, reptiles, and arachnids, should speak with the exterminator to determine the best action to prevent the animals from being harmed by chemicals.
